What is propstream and who uses it
Propstream is a U.S.-based property intelligence platform that aggregates public records, multiple listing service data, and owner contact details to help real estate professionals research and contact property owners.
The platform and its users
The service attracts property investors, real estate agents, and asset managers who need access to comprehensive property datasets and lead-generation tools for prospecting and market research. How to cancel propstream step by step
Propstream does not offer a self-service cancellation option, so you must contact their support team directly - here's exactly how to do it.
Cancel a direct web subscription
- Locate your Propstream account email and any recent billing statement or invoice.
- You'll need your account details to verify your identity with support.
- Contact Propstream's U.S. customer support team by phone or email.
- Phone: 1-877-204-9040 (U.S. toll-free number; call rates from New Zealand will apply as an international call).
- Email: Use the contact address listed in your account settings or on your most recent billing email from Propstream.
- When you contact them, state clearly: "I want to cancel my Propstream subscription effective immediately" or "at the end of my current billing cycle."
- Specify your preferred cancellation date - end of cycle or now - because this affects your refund eligibility.
- Confirm the cancellation in writing.
- If you called, ask for confirmation via email. If you emailed, retain a copy of your request and watch for their acknowledgment.
- Pro tip: Screenshot or photograph your email confirmation and save it - you may need this evidence if a dispute arises later.
- Verify that auto-renewal has been disabled.
- Log into your Propstream account and check that the renewal toggle is off, or ask support to confirm the setting has been updated.
- Watch for your final billing statement.
- If you cancelled mid-cycle, you may be charged through to the end of the current period - this is standard and legal in New Zealand.
Cancel an apple app store subscription
- Open the Apple App Store app on your iPhone or iPad.
- Tap your profile icon in the top right corner.
- Select "Subscriptions" from the menu.
- You'll see a list of all active subscriptions linked to your Apple ID.
- Tap "Propstream" (or the name shown for your subscription).
- If Propstream does not appear, it may already be cancelled or you may be subscribed via the website instead.
- Tap "Cancel Subscription."
- Apple may prompt you to confirm or offer a retention discount - decide whether to proceed or reconsider.
- Confirm the cancellation via the on-screen prompt.
- You'll receive an email confirmation from Apple; retain this for your records.
Cancel a google play subscription
- Open the Google Play Store app on your Android phone or tablet.
- Tap the profile icon in the top right corner.
- Select "Payments and subscriptions."
- Then tap "Subscriptions."
- Tap "Propstream" (or the name shown for your subscription).
- If you don't see it listed, it may have been cancelled already or purchased via the website.
- Tap "Cancel subscription."
- Google Play will ask you to confirm; you may also see a retention offer.
- Confirm the cancellation.
- You'll receive an email confirmation from Google; save this as proof.

Refund policy and your rights under the consumer guarantees act
New Zealand consumer law gives you specific protections that Propstream must respect, even though the company is based in the U.S.
Propstream's standard refund stance
Propstream treats monthly subscription fees as non-refundable once the billing cycle has begun. This is their stated policy, and in most cases, they will refuse refunds if you cancel mid-cycle. However, this blanket refusal does not override your legal rights as a New Zealand consumer.
The consumer guarantees act protects you
Under New Zealand's Consumer Guarantees Act, any digital service or software supplied to you must be of acceptable quality, fit for purpose, and as described. If Propstream is faulty, doesn't work as advertised, or fails to deliver on promised features, you are entitled to a remedy - repair, replacement, or refund - regardless of Propstream's stated cancellation policy. Pro tip: If you believe the service failed to meet these standards, document the failures with screenshots and dates, then escalate your complaint beyond their initial support response.
Escalating a refund dispute
If Propstream refuses a legitimate refund claim and you believe your rights under the Consumer Guarantees Act have been breached, you can escalate to:
- Citizens Advice Bureau: www.cab.org.nz - free advice on consumer disputes.
- Disputes Tribunal: www.disputestribunal.govt.nz - independent resolution for claims up to NZD $7,500 (or $15,000 by agreement).
- Commerce Commission: If you suspect systematic unfair practices, report the company for investigation.

Common cancellation mistakes to avoid
Cancelling a subscription sounds simple, but small oversights can cost you money or leave you stranded without proof of your request.
Thinking cancellation is immediate
Many users assume that once they click "cancel," access ends that day. In reality, Propstream charges you through the end of your billing cycle, and your access continues until that date. If you need to cut off access sooner - for security or business reasons - contact support and ask for an immediate cancellation exception, but expect to pay the full month regardless.
Cancelling via app but forgetting to cancel the web account
If you subscribed through multiple channels (web and app), you must cancel each separately. Cancelling your Apple App Store subscription doesn't automatically cancel your direct Propstream account. Check all three potential subscription points: the Propstream website, the Apple App Store, and Google Play. Stopee users often find themselves still being charged because they missed one channel.
Not keeping proof of cancellation
Support staff can change, records can get lost, and if you're later billed by mistake, your only defence is written proof of your cancellation request. Always request written confirmation - email, screenshot, or support ticket number - and store it safely for at least 12 months.
Failing to check for hidden auto-renewal
Some subscriptions re-enable auto-renewal if you log back into the app or update your payment method. After cancelling, avoid logging in unless necessary, and periodically check your subscription settings to confirm renewal has stayed off. Warning: If Propstream charges you again after cancellation, you can dispute the charge with your bank as an unauthorised transaction.
